I am trying to compare a string variable to an element of a string array using a for loop in visual basic. I am comparing a user-entered string variable to an array with the lowercase alphabet, in order. I have some logical mistake because my "count" variable is always on 25 for some reason, and therefore it always says "Sorry, Try again" unless the user types a Z. Can anyone tell me why this is happening or know a more efficient way to do this? Thank you.
Dim lower() As String = {"a", "b", "c", "d", "e", "f", "g", "h", "i", "j", "k", "l", "m", "n", "o", "p", "q", "r", "s", "t", "u", "v", "w", "x", "y", "z"}
For count As Integer = 0 To 25
input = txtInput.Text
input = input.ToLower
If input.Equals(lower(count)) Then
txtResult.Text = "Correct"
Else
txtResult.Text = "Sorry, Try again"
End If
Next
